M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
examines
issues
regarding open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
New
developments in
e-learning technology are enabling
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in classes online.
Massive open online courses are
free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
issues that
elearning technology organizations
have to struggle with
now that elearning technology is
developing so quickly.
How can organizations
assure that
the quality of instruction provided by these
massive open online courses is
all right?
How can participants
make sure that
instructors are properly credentialed
to teach online MOOC courses?
What business models are being used by
organizations like
FutureLearn to conduct these massive open online courses?
What teaching practices and original assessment strategies are in use today?
How can stakeholders
deal with the problems of
inadequate
learner motivation and high
learner attrition?
